Byron Crescent - MK45 1PY
Key Postcode Insights
MK45 1PY is a residential postcode situated on Byron Crescent, Flitwick, Bedford, MK45 with 19 addresses.
It ranks as the 750th largest and 795th most expensive of the 1,226 postcodes in the MK45 area. The most common property type is a mid-century house built between 1936 and 1979.
The postcode contains a total of 19 properties: 19 houses.
